Difficulty Opening or Closing Your Mouth



Experiencing problem opening up or closing your mouth is a clear indicator that you should get in touch with an oral cosmetic surgeon immediately. This symptom can be an indication of numerous underlying oral health and wellness concerns that need prompt interest.

-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order: TMJ problem influences the joint that links your jawbone to your head. It can create discomfort and rigidity, making it difficult to relocate your jaw.

- Lockjaw: Lockjaw, additionally known as trismus, is a problem where the jaw muscles spasm and avoid normal mouth opening.

- Oral Cancer: Trouble in mouth motion can be an early sign of oral cancer cells. It's essential to get it checked by a dental doctor.

- Infection: An infection in the oral cavity or salivary glands can create swelling and trouble in mouth motion.

- Trauma: Injury to the jaw or face can result in issues with jaw activity.

If you experience trouble opening up or closing your mouth, do not postpone seeking professional aid from a dental surgeon.

Loose or Shifting Pearly Whites



If you discover your teeth becoming loose or changing, it's important to speak with a dental surgeon quickly. This could be an indication of a significant oral issue that calls for timely focus. Here are some reasons that loosened or shifting teeth should not be neglected:

- Injury or injury: Teeth can become loose as a result of a blow to the mouth or face. An oral cosmetic surgeon can assess the damage and provide ideal therapy.

- Gum illness: Advanced gum disease can create the supporting structures of the teeth to compromise, resulting in tooth flexibility. A dental surgeon can evaluate the level of the condition and recommend treatment choices.

- Tooth decay: Extreme decay can weaken the stability of the tooth, creating it to become loosened. A dental doctor can figure out the most effective strategy.

- Bite problems: Misaligned teeth or an inappropriate bite can trigger teeth to move or become loose. A dental cosmetic surgeon can resolve these issues and prevent more damages.

- Bone loss: Sometimes, bone loss in the jaw can trigger teeth to end up being loose. A dental doctor can assess the situation and provide proper therapy to bring back security.

Hitting or Popping Jaw Joint



Do you experience a clicking or standing out feeling in your jaw joint? This could be an indicator that you require to consult a dental cosmetic surgeon quickly.

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, also called the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can suggest a problem with the joint's positioning or function. It may be caused by problems such as TMJ condition, joint inflammation, or a displaced disc in the joint.

This hitting or popping can result in discomfort, pain, and trouble in opening or closing your mouth. If left without treatment, it can worsen and influence your life.

Consequently, it is very important to look for the proficiency of an oral doctor who can diagnose the underlying reason and supply proper therapy choices to minimize your signs and symptoms and prevent more issues.
